CMS, Logan Middle girls pick up wins

The Chapmanville Middle School girls’ basketball team walked away with a 53-28 win over Sherman on Monday night at home.

The Lady Tigers used a blistering fast break offense to outgun a much bigger Sherman squad.

Lexi Martin led Chapmanville with 18 points. Hollie Carter had 13 while Abigail Marcum also reached double digits in scoring with 12 points.

Richelle Thompson had six and Taylor Manns four.

“We started slow, but their size hurt us on the boards,” CMS coach Tommy Kirk said. “We finally got our running game going and took control of the game.”

In the JV game, Chapmanville rolled to an easy 25-2 victory over the Tide.

Reese Ellis had six points to lead the Lady Tigers. Reese Ellis had six and Jacy Baxter four. Nadia Perry, Beth Ball, Kaylee Blair, Haven Adkins, Tabitha Adkins, Madison Webb and Chloe Sweeney all had two points each for CMS. Kelsey Shadd had one point.

Next up for the Lady Tigers is a Thursday game against Van.

Logan 45,

Lenore 24

It was a winning start to the season last week for the Logan Middle School girls’ basketball team, which won 45-24 over the Lenore Rangers.

Logan was led by Tomi Nelson with 12 points.

Beth Adkins and Lexi Hines each netted 10, while Chelsea Napier had five points.

It was a double win for the Lady Wolves as the LMS girls’ JV team was also a 37-17 winner over Lenore. LMS was led in scoring by Britney Welch with seven points. Zoe Browning and Stephanie Eplin each had six.

Logan is scheduled to play host to Cardinal Conference opponent Ripley Middle School on Wednesday night.

BOYS

Harts 52, Man 26

The Harts Middle School boys’ basketball team breezed to a 52-26 win at home over Man on Monday night.

Drew Williamson paced Harts with 19 points. Kyle Browning reached double digits as well with 16 points. Ty Sturm had six, C.J. Dalton four and Caleb Ellis three. Hunter Brumfield and Trinity Maynard tossed in two each.

Daniel Buchanan led Man with 11 points. Tyler Grimmett had six and John McCoy four. Cameron Simpson and Mike Sorrell had two apiece. Jackson Porter chipped in with one point.

Harts (3-0) opened the season Nov. 29 with a 49-21 win at Duval. The Lions then won 54-36 on Dec. 6 at Sherman.
